Kam Kola (Persian:كامكلا)[a] is a village inKhvosh Rud Rural District[4] ofBandpey-e Gharbi District inBabol County,Mazandaran province,Iran.
At the time of the 2006 National Census, the village's population was 573 in 144 households.[5] The following census in 2011 counted 567 people in 169 households.[6] The 2016 census measured the population of the village as 595 people in 192 households.[3]
